A quiet town. A hidden system. One murder meant to stay buried.

When beloved schoolteacher Lila Mae Harper is found dead in an abandoned house on the edge of Briar Hollow, authorities are quick to rule it an accident.

Former detective Evan Crowe knows better.

Back in his hometown after years away, Evan sees what others refuse to look at: the scene was staged, the evidence trimmed, the truth quietly managed. As he digs deeper, a simple murder investigation fractures into something far darker—a decades-old system built to erase mistakes, silence questions, and keep a town alive at any cost.

Beneath Briar Hollow lies a hidden infrastructure:

  • secret routes

  • falsified records

  • poisoned water

  • and a house designed not for living… but for disposal

As Evan follows the trail, he uncovers a ledger that was never meant to be read, a conspiracy protected by badges and paperwork, and a killer who doesn’t believe he’s evil—only necessary.

The closer Evan gets, the more violent the town becomes.

Because some places don’t fear murder.

They fear exposure.
